Edible Flowers and Versatile Use
Adding a unique dimension, the flowers of Double Frappe Light Pink 2 (F1) Snapdragon are edible. Their floral and slightly bitter flavor makes them a colorful garnish for salads, desserts, and drinks. Use them sparingly to add a touch of elegance and visual appeal to your culinary creations. Primarily valued as a cut flower, its excellent vase life of 7-10 days and good storage temperature of 0-4°C make it a valuable addition to any cut flower production.
Optimal Growing Instructions for Best Results
Sowing Instructions: Transplanting is highly recommended. Surface-sow the Double Frappe Light Pink 2 (F1) Snapdragon seeds into your preferred seedling container 8-10 weeks before your intended planting-out date. Light is crucial for germination, so cover the seeds just enough to hold them in place. Pinching young plants is recommended if you desire a bushier plant with more branching and increased flower production. A fine layer of vermiculite over the seeds can help maintain necessary moisture levels and prevent algae growth without blocking light. Bottom water or mist lightly to avoid displacing seeds and soil. Transplant seedlings to cell packs or larger containers when the first true leaves appear, typically 3-4 weeks after sowing. If pinching is desired, do so when plants have formed 4-6 leaves or are approximately 3-4 inches tall, cutting them back by half their height. Pinching will delay the crop time by a few weeks. If pinching, space plants 6-12 inches apart. Direct seeding is not recommended for this variety.
- Flower Color: Light pink
- Plant Height: 30–40 inches
- Days to Germination: 7-14 days
- Sowing: Transplant (recommended), surface sow 8-10 weeks before planting out
- Light Preference: Sun/Part Shade (light required for germination)
- Stem Length: 12-60 inches
- Vase Life: 7-10 days
- Soil Requirements: Rich, well-drained, moist; neutral pH
- Uses: Cut flower, edible flower
